Lines Matching refs:write_zsreg
142 static void write_zsreg(struct zilog_channel __iomem *channel, in write_zsreg() function
199 write_zsreg(channel, R1, in __load_zsregs()
203 write_zsreg(channel, R4, regs[R4]); in __load_zsregs()
206 write_zsreg(channel, R10, regs[R10]); in __load_zsregs()
209 write_zsreg(channel, R3, regs[R3] & ~RxENAB); in __load_zsregs()
210 write_zsreg(channel, R5, regs[R5] & ~TxENAB); in __load_zsregs()
213 write_zsreg(channel, R6, regs[R6]); in __load_zsregs()
214 write_zsreg(channel, R7, regs[R7]); in __load_zsregs()
222 write_zsreg(channel, R14, regs[R14] & ~BRENAB); in __load_zsregs()
225 write_zsreg(channel, R11, regs[R11]); in __load_zsregs()
228 write_zsreg(channel, R12, regs[R12]); in __load_zsregs()
229 write_zsreg(channel, R13, regs[R13]); in __load_zsregs()
232 write_zsreg(channel, R14, regs[R14]); in __load_zsregs()
235 write_zsreg(channel, R15, (regs[R15] | WR7pEN) & ~FIFOEN); in __load_zsregs()
240 write_zsreg(channel, R7, regs[R7p]); in __load_zsregs()
243 write_zsreg(channel, R15, regs[R15] & ~WR7pEN); in __load_zsregs()
252 write_zsreg(channel, R0, RES_EXT_INT); /* First Latch */ in __load_zsregs()
253 write_zsreg(channel, R0, RES_EXT_INT); /* Second Latch */ in __load_zsregs()
256 write_zsreg(channel, R3, regs[R3]); in __load_zsregs()
257 write_zsreg(channel, R5, regs[R5]); in __load_zsregs()
260 write_zsreg(channel, R1, regs[R1]); in __load_zsregs()
665 write_zsreg(channel, R5, up->curregs[R5]); in sunzilog_set_mctrl()
746 write_zsreg(channel, R15, up->curregs[R15] & ~WR7pEN); in sunzilog_enable_ms()
772 write_zsreg(channel, R5, up->curregs[R5]); in sunzilog_break_ctl()
1337 write_zsreg(channel, R9, FHWRES); in sunzilog_init_hw()
1356 write_zsreg(channel, R9, up->curregs[R9]); in sunzilog_init_hw()
1382 write_zsreg(channel, R9, up->curregs[R9]); in sunzilog_init_hw()
1592 write_zsreg(channel, R9, up->curregs[R9]); in sunzilog_init()
1629 write_zsreg(channel, R9, up->curregs[R9]); in sunzilog_exit()